B. Alexander et al., Stratospheric CO2 isotopic anomalies and SF6 and CFC tracer concentrationsin the Arctic polar vortex, GEOPHYS R L, 28(21), 2001, pp. 4103-4106
Isotopic measurements (delta O-17 and delta O-18) Of CO2 along with concent
ration measurements of SF6, CC1(3)F (CFC-11), CC1(2)F(2) (CFC-12) and CC1(2
)FCC1F(2) (CFC-113) in stratospheric samples collected within the Arctic po
lar vortex are reported. These are the first simultaneous measurements of t
he concentration of fluorinated compounds and the complete oxygen isotopic
composition Of CO2 in the middle atmosphere. A mass-independent anomaly in
the oxygen isotopic composition Of CO2 is observed that arises from isotopi
c exchange with stratospheric O(D-1) derived from O-3 photolysis. The data
exhibit a strong anti-correlation between the Delta O-17 (the degree of the
mass-independent anomaly) and molecular tracer concentrations. The potenti
al ability of tl-ris isotopic proxy to trace mesospheric and stratospheric
transport is discussed.
